There have been some impressive responses to Kanye West 's recent Twitter rant about his millions of debt - but Pizza Hut just won hands down.
The rapper announced he owed $53million recently in a string of social media posts, writing: "I write this to you my brothers while still 53 million dollars in personal debt... Please pray we overcome... This is my true heart..."
But as fans reacted to the news online, the rapper later took to Twitter to defend himself, admitting he needed the extra money to "bring more beautiful ideas to the world".
It's fair to say the response from fans was incredible - but Pizza Hut UK's official Twitter page came out top with one of the best reactions ever.
Seeing the string of tweets, the food chain stepped up and quickly offered the rapper a job - "kneading dough".
Their Twitter page wrote: "Stop telling everyone you need dough and try kneading some dough. We got your C.V. today. You start at 9am tomorrow."
After Kanye wrote: "But I need access to more money in order to bring more beautiful ideas to the world," they responded: "We're sorry Kanye. We just can't accept this. Please give us a call."
